How long are KFC biscuits good for?
If your biscuits are stored in the pantry, they will last 2 to 4 days. If you need to store them longer, the fridge might be a better option. They will stay fresh for up to 1 week in the refrigerator.Blind Biscuit Taste Test

Method 1: Reheat Biscuits In The Oven
- Preheat the oven to 350°F.
-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or foil. Arrange the biscuits so they're spaced well apart and are not touching.
- Bake the biscuits for 5 to 7 minutes.
- Remove the biscuits from the oven and enjoy with butter.
